概述
随着共享经济与出行方式的不断升级,汽车租赁行业正逐步迈向数字化、智能化管理。为帮助开发者快速掌握基于 SpringBoot 的 JavaWeb 项目开发流程,幽络源源码网特别推出一款功能完整的 SpringBoot 汽车租赁系统。该系统采用前后端分离架构设计,涵盖车辆管理、用户租赁、订单处理等核心业务模块,适用于个人租车平台、企业用车管理或教学实训场景。无论是初学者还是有一定经验的 Java 开发者,都可以通过本源码深入理解权限控制、数据交互与业务逻辑的设计思路,是学习企业级 Web 系统开发的理想选择。
主要内容
本 SpringBoot 汽车租赁系统分为两大角色:管理员 和 普通用户,各模块职责清晰,权限分明,确保系统的安全性与可维护性。
一、管理员功能模块
作为系统的最高权限角色,管理员拥有全面的运营管理能力:
- 首页:查看系统概览与关键数据统计(如总车辆数、活跃用户、订单数量等)。
- 个人中心:管理个人信息与账户设置。
- 用户管理:对注册用户进行增删改查操作,支持状态启用/禁用。
- 车辆品牌管理:维护所有车辆品牌信息(如丰田、本田、大众等),支持新增与编辑。
- 车辆信息管理:统一管理所有在租车辆的基本信息,包括车型、排量、座位数、图片、租金等。
- 车辆颜色管理:定义并管理车辆颜色选项,便于分类展示。
- 租赁订单列表:查看所有用户的租赁订单,支持按时间、状态筛选。
- 还车记录管理:记录并审核每辆车的归还情况,更新车辆状态。
- 管理员管理:支持多管理员账号配置与权限分配(适用于团队运营)。
- 我的收藏管理:查看用户收藏的车辆信息(可选功能,用于数据联动)。
- 系统管理:进行系统参数配置、日志管理与基础设置。
二、用户功能模块
普通用户为租车主体,主要功能包括:
- 首页:浏览推荐车辆、热门车型及促销活动。
- 个人中心:管理个人信息、联系方式与账户安全。
- 车辆信息管理:查看所有可租车辆,支持按品牌、颜色、价格区间筛选。
- 租赁订单列表:查看已提交的租赁订单状态(待支付、已确认、已完成等),支持订单详情查询。
- 还车记录管理:查看自己的还车历史,确认车辆归还状态。
结语
本《SpringBoot汽车租赁系统》源码结构清晰、功能完整,已通过本地环境调试运行稳定,支持数据库持久化与前后端交互逻辑。系统具备良好的扩展性,适合高校教学、项目实战、小型租车平台部署使用。代码注释详尽,数据库设计合理,是学习 JavaWeb 开发、掌握 SpringBoot 实战应用的优质资源。
如果不会部署或需要更精品的源码或定制开发服务,欢迎加入我们的QQ群 307531422 交流咨询,幽络源将为您提供更多优质的技术资源和服务。
源码下载
https://pan.quark.cn/s/618be43a814e
预览图






THE END

